Designation:D251094(Reapproved 2012)Standard Test Method forAdhesion of Solid Film Lubricants1This standard is issued under the fixed designation D2510;the number immediately following the designation indicates the year oforiginal adoption or,in the case of revision,the year of last revision.A number in parentheses indicates the year of last reapproval.Asuperscript epsilon()indicates an editorial change since the last revision or reapproval.This standard has been approved for use by agencies of the Department of Defense.1.Scope1.1 This test method2covers the measurement of the adhe-sion characteristics of dry solid film lubricants.1.2 The values stated in SI units are to be regarded asstandard.The values given in parentheses are provided forinformation only.1.3 This standard does not purport to address all of thesafety concerns,if any,associated with its use.It is theresponsibility of the user of this standard to establish appro-priate safety and health practices and determine the applica-bility of regulatory limitations prior to use.2.Referenced Documents2.1 ASTM Standards:3B209M Specification for Aluminum and Aluminum-AlloySheet and Plate(Metric)D1000 Test Methods for Pressure-Sensitive Adhesive-Coated Tapes Used for Electrical and Electronic Applica-tionsD1193 Specification for Reagent WaterD1730 PracticesforPreparationof AluminumandAluminum-Alloy Surfaces for PaintingD3330/D3330M Test Method for PeelAdhesion of Pressure-Sensitive TapeF22 Test Method for Hydrophobic Surface Films by theWater-Break Test2.2 U.S.Military Specification:4MIL-L-460103.Terminology3.1 Definitions:3.1.1 dry solid film lubricants,ndry coatings consisting oflubricating powders in a solid matrix bonded to one or bothsurfaces to be lubricated.4.Summary of Test Method4.1 The dry solid film lubricant is applied to anodizedaluminum panels,immersed in water or other fluids for 24 h,and then wiped dry.A strip of masking tape is pressed onto thepanel and removed abruptly.Film removal exposing thesurface of the metal panel is the criterion for failure.5.Significance and Use5.1 Effective solid film lubricant coatings must adhere tosurfaces to provide adequate lubrication in applications withrestricted access where fluid lubricants cannot easily be replen-ished.Loss of coating adhesion results in metal to metalcontact causing significant wear of contacting surfaces.Adhe-sion is critical to the performance of the solid film lubricant.Examples of solid film lubricant applications include fasteners,bearings and sliding members in automotive,aircraft,andaerospace hardware.5.2 This test method is intended to determine the adhesionof solid film lubricant coatings when submitted to contact withwater and other fluids.Results of this test provide an indicationof the suitability of the lubricant coating in applications wherecontact with water or other fluids is likely.6.Apparatus6.1 Rubber Covered Steel RollerA steel roller,82.6 6 2.5mm(3.25 6 0.1 in.)in diameter and 44.5 6 1.3 mm(1.75 60.05 in.)in width,covered with rubber approximately 6.4 mm(14in.)in thickness having a durometer hardness of 80 6 5.The weight of the roller proper which applies pressure to thespecimen shall be 2.04 6 0.05 kg(4.5 6 0.1 lb).It shall be soconstructed that the weight of the handle is not added to theweight of the
